海权论与俄罗斯海权地理不利性评析   总被引:3,自引:0,他引:3  
本文概要介绍了马汉的海权理论及俄罗斯的海权思想与实践。提出海岸条件、出海通道、海岸间的地理联系是制约海权发展的三个最直接的地理因素。在此基础上,分析了俄罗斯的海权地理状况,指出俄罗斯海权发展存在显著的、巨大的地理制约性。  相似文献

Geochemical analysis of six radiometrically dated short cores of recent sediment from Lake Baikal shows clear evidence of enhanced Pb supply. However, the sediment concentration increases are very small; the average Pb concentration rises from a baseline value of 10.9 g g-1 to a peak value of only 14.8 g g-1. In contrast to the more polluted lakes commonly studied in Europe and North America, variation in Pb concentration is far more strongly influenced by natural variation than by pollution. In sediment deposited over the last 150–200 years 73% of the variance in the sediment Pb concentration can be accounted for by variation in bulk composition of the sediment, and by atmospheric pollution. Factors influencing Pb concentrations over this time period are, in order of decreasing average importance (fraction of total variance explained), catchment supply (indicated by 226Ra activity variation) (43%), anthropogenic Pb emissions (24%), and dilution by ferromanganese hydroxides (6%). On longer (1000s of years) time scales dilution by biogenic silica is probably more important.The recent enhanced supply of catchment Pb correlates with accelerating accumulation rates, indicating a link with enhanced erosion. Anthropogenic sources dominate only in the southern basin, where local fossil-fuel burning industry is situated. The evidence for a local industrial source for the Pb pollution is strengthened by the high correlation between the inventories for Pb and for spheroidal carbonaceous particles. The absence of detectable anthropogenic Pb enrichment in the northern part of the lake suggests that long-distance Pb pollution is small compared with the local natural supply.  相似文献

The expansion of the Internet and e-mail access around the globe, especially into less-developed areas, raises the question of how geographers might use this technology for research purposes and the development of appropriate methodologies. This paper identifies three ways in which the use of e-mail surveys for geographic research differs from traditional mail surveys. First, there are substantial differences in selecting an appropriate sample population. Second, electronic medium considerations such as alphabet character translation, survey format, and receiving end conditions pose unique data collection challenges. Third, ascertaining that e-mail addresses to be included in a survey are operative is discussed as a useful means of maximizing the potential of an e-mail survey. Examples from an e-mail survey of environmentalists in Russia illustrate these points.  相似文献

Concentrations of Cd, Cr, Cu, Ni and Pb were determined in filtered water, suspended particulate matter, and bottom sediments from a 2000 km section of the Ob and Irtysh Rivers. Dissolved Cd, Cr, Cu and Ni concentrations are similar to, or higher than, results from other Russian Arctic and large world river-estuaries. Concentrations of Cd, Cr, Cu, Ni and Pb in suspended particulate matter are generally comparable to results from other Russian Arctic and large world rivers and estuaries. Comparison of trace metal ratios in crustal material and suspended particulate matter and bottom sediment suggests that the source of Cr, Cu and Ni is continental weathering. Particulate Cd and Pb are elevated relative to their crustal abundance, suggesting a source of these metals to the Ob-Irtysh in addition to continental weathering.  相似文献

This paper examines migration in Russia during the period that preceded the breakup of the former Soviet Union (FSU) and during the current transition period. An unusually rich dataset is used to conceptualize the impact that the political and economic collapse of a world superpower has on a migration system. A regional case study of migration in Yaroslavl' Oblast from 1989 through 1992 is used to examine the relevance of expected outcomes given standard theories of migration, empirical regularities found in capitalist economies, and past trends in the FSU. The data clearly show a migration system undergoing political and economic shocks. A significant decline of the volume of flows and a relative increase in the importance of interrepublic movement indicate disruptions. Increased relative mobility for those in the later years of the working-age population and increased importance of urban-to-rural migration flows are also important changes evident in this migration system undergoing shock.  相似文献

Russia, Ukraine and Kazakhstan have each participated actively in the UN Framework Convention on Climate Change (UNFCCC) Conferences of the Parties, and each is developing domestic rules and institutions to address UN obligations under the treaties. Russia and Ukraine are each Annex I/Annex B countries. Kazakhstan will become Annex I upon ratification of the Kyoto Protocol, but has not yet established itself as Annex B. Each state has evolved a distinct set of policies and priorities in the domestic and the international arena. Drawing largely on interviews in each country, this article presents brief histories of the evolution of climate policy, focusing on each state’s behavior in the international arena, the sources of domestic policy leadership, and the forces that led to change in each national approach. Current policies and practices are evaluated with an eye towards learning from the successes and failures in each state.  相似文献

Abstract: Age of magmatism and tin mineralization in the Khingan‐Okhotsk volcano–plutonic belt, including the Khingan, Badzhal and Komsomolsk tin fields, were reviewed in terms of tectonic history of the continental margin of East Asia. This belt consists mainly of felsic volcanic rocks and granitoids of the reduced type, being free of remarkable geomagnetic anomaly, in contrast with the northern Sikhote‐Alin volcano–plutonic belt dominated by oxidized‐type rocks and gold mineralization. The northern end of the Khingan‐Okhotsk belt near the Sea of Okhotsk, accompanied by positive geomagnetic anomalies, may have been overprinted by magmatism of the Sikhote‐Alin belt. Tin–associated magmatism in the Khingan‐Okhotsk belt extending over 400 km occurred episodically in a short period (9510 Ma) in the middle Cretaceous time, which is coeval with the accretion of the Kiselevka‐Manoma complex, the youngest accretionary wedge in the eastern margin of the Khingan‐Okhotsk accretionary terranes. The episodic magmatism is in contrast with the Cretaceous‐Paleogene long–lasted magmatism in Sikhote–Alin, indicating the two belts are essentially different arcs, rather than juxtaposed arcs derived from a single arc. The tin‐associated magmatism may have been caused by the subduction of a young and hot back‐arc basin, which is inferred from oceanic plate stratigraphy of the coeval accre‐tionary complex and its heavy mineral assemblage of immature volcanic arc provenance. The subduction of the young basin may have resulted in dominance of the reduced‐type felsic magmas due to incorporation of carbonaceous sediments within the accretionary complex near the trench. Subsequently, the back‐arc basin may have been closed by the oblique collision of the accretionary terranes in Sikhote–Alin, which was subjected to the Late Cretaceous to Paleogene magmatism related to another younger subduction system. These processes could have proceeded under transpressional tectonic regime due to oblique subduction of the paleo‐Pacific plates under Eurasian continent.  相似文献

The World Summit on Sustainable Development (26 August–4 September 2002), held in Johannesburg on the tenth anniversary of the first Earth Summit, provides the opportunity to reflect on the meaning of the sustainable development concept. This paper uses the case study of the Russian Federation to explore the relationship between official interpretations of sustainable development and alternative understandings concerned with the betterment of humankind, which draw on Russia's cultural and scientific heritage. It is suggested that there is much to be gained from reopening the sustainable development debate to incorporate such cultural particularities, both at the national and international levels.  相似文献

李宇  孟丹  叶海鹏  张宁  郑吉  李飞  董锁成 《地理研究》2021,40(11):2967-2985
本研究以社会经济发展统计数据和多源遥感影像数据为基础,通过决策融合遥感解译方法、多元离散回归模型、质心迁移、扇形分析法等,重点考察了伊尔库茨克(Irkutsk)、新西伯利亚(Novosibirsk)、叶卡捷琳堡(Yekaterinburg)分别在1990年、2000年、2010年、2018年城市不透水面的扩张特征,探讨了不同城市扩张的自然环境变化与社会经济发展耦合作用与驱动机制。首先不同城市的扩张方向、强度、速度、模式上存在显著时空差异,三个城市分别呈现“快速增长-增长-慢速增长”“增长-增长-慢速增长”“慢速增长-增长-慢速增长”发展趋势,其中叶卡捷琳堡扩张强度最高。而城市新增不透水面的扩张类型以蔓延式和跳跃式扩张为主,填充式扩张所占比重较小。其次典型城市扩张主要发展方向不同,伊尔库茨克城市扩张特征由南北发展向转为放射状发展,新西伯利亚由东西向发展向正西方向发展,叶卡捷琳堡城市扩张特征由放射状发展向西南方向发展,其发展方向与其自然、区位以及社会因素有关,其中自然因素和区位因素是俄罗斯三类典型城市扩张的主导因素。最后文章阐述不同类型的俄罗斯城市其发展方向与城市发展潜力,为其同类型城市发展提供科学管理依据。伊尔库茨克借助丰富旅游资源重视城市内旅游产业发展,新西伯利亚由于历史问题,对城市内外部交通网络布局提出更高标准规划,叶卡捷琳堡作为俄罗斯国内较发达城市,可加强和周边城市联系形成具有联动作用的城市群。对中国东北地区同类型城市发展规划有着一定的启示意义,包括加强发展紧凑城市、注重交通设施建设、加强周边城市联动、发展旅游等。  相似文献

The duration of travel climate comfort degree is an important factor that influences the length of the tourism season and the development of a tourism destination. In this study, we used the monthly average meteorological data for the last 10 years from 46 weather stations in Heilongjiang Province (China) and Primorsky Krai (Russia) to calculate the temperature-humidity index (THI) and wind chill index (WCI) based on ArcGIS software interpolation technology. We obtained the climate comfort charts of the study area with a grid size a 1 km 2 grid size, and analyzed the spatial distribution of comfort for each month. The results show the following: 1) The THI and WCI of the cross-border region gradually decrease from south to north and from low altitude to high altitude. The annual comfortable climate period is longer when analyzed in terms of the WCI rather \than the THI. 2) The travel climate comfortable period of the study area shows significant regional difference and the length of the comfortable period in Heilongjiang Province is 4 to 5 months. Meanwhile, the period in Primorsky Krai decreases from south to north and the length of the comfortable period length in its southern region can reach 7 months. 3) The predominant length of the climate comfortable period in the cross-border area is 5 months per year, and it covers 46.6% of the total area, while areas that have a climate comfortable period of 2 months are the most limited, covering less than 0.3% of the area. The results provide a scientific basis for the utilization and development of a meteorological tourism resources and touring arrangements for tourists in the cross-border region between China and Russia.  相似文献
